Publishing a PagePorter Web Site

Your PagePorter web site is a special kind of ASP.NET web application, so use the Visual Studio .NET Copy Project command to publish the project.

If your project contains web pages that were originally authored in FrontPage, Visual Studio may reformat the page while publishing, causing the shared borders and other information to be changed, or in many cases removed altogether. To prevent publishing problems, you should do one of the following:

If your PagePorter web site is co-managed with FrontPage, make sure you use either the “Copy only files needed to run this application” or “Copy all project files” option. If you use the “Copy all files in the project folder” option, you may improperly publish some of the FrontPage files.
